From Account Management to Technology and Product, whatever your skills are, you'll find your fit here.THE ROLEWe seek an experienced and innovative Analytics Engineer to join our Data Analytics & Experimentation team at Farfetch.
This role will focus on the evolution of our award-winning in-house experimentation platform, with a special emphasis on advancing our custom statistical engine that processes test results and enables self-service, automated analytics for teams across the company.
This is a unique opportunity to contribute to a cutting-edge platform that drives critical insights for one of the world's largest luxury fashion platforms.
As a Data Analytics Engineer, you will collaborate with data analysts, data engineers, and product managers to optimise our experimentation and Data infrastructure, ensuring robustness, scalability, and flexibility to meet the analytical needs of Farfetch teams globally.WHAT YOU'LL DOExperimentation Platform Development: Work closely with cross-functional teams to continuously enhance our in-house experimentation platform, including building and refining features within our custom statistical engine.Statistical Processing: Support and enhance the platform's ability to process large-scale statistical tests, including A/B and multivariate tests, with a focus on delivering accurate, actionable insights across teams.Data Engineering: Design and implement efficient, scalable data pipelines and ETL processes for experimentation data, ensuring reliable data flow from ingestion through to final analysis.Self-Service Analytics: Develop self-service capabilities, enabling non-technical users to perform automated deep dives and access critical insights independently.Quality and Testing: Implement robust testing frameworks to ensure the accuracy and reliability of experimentation results, and automate quality checks for all analytical outputs
